Slight drop in support for Sinn Féin, poll suggests



Support for Sinn Féin has dropped slightly to 29%, the latest Sunday Independent/Ireland Thinks opinion poll suggests.

It represents a 1 point decrease on the previous comparable poll.

The poll also suggests that support for Independents and others has surpassed Fianna Fáil.

Fine Gael has experienced a marginal drop in support, down 1 to 19%.

Coalition partners Fianna Fáil remain unchanged on 17%.

The Social Democrats are also unchanged at 5%. The Labour Party is up one to 4%.

The Greens, Solidarity/People Before Profit and Aontú are all unchanged and all stand at 3%.

Finally, support for Independents and others has increased by one point to 18%

The poll was taken on Thursday and Friday of this week among a sample size of 1,394 people with a margin of error of +/- 2.7%.
